SPW31002S Bipolar Tone Elektronische Bauelemente RoHS Compliant Product Ringer ICs Description The SPW31002S is a bipolar integrated circuit. It is designed for telephone bell replacment. Note 2.Sustaining Supply Voltage (Vsus) is a supply voltage required to maintain oscillation of the tone ringer. Note 3.Oscillation frequency is determined by the following equations (1), (2) and (3) (1) fL = 1/1.234, R1, C1 (Hz) (2) fH1=1/1.515, R2, C2 (Hz) (3) fH2=1.24 fH1 (Hz) Method of Using Rsl In the SPW31002S, using the RSL terminal can change the initiation supply current (Isi). The resistor RSL is connected to Gnd from Pin 2 as show in Fig. 3. Further, the initiation supply current (Isi) can be changing the value of RSL. Fig. 4 shows the graph of Vs-Is characteristic at the time when RSL has been changed to three values. The Vs-Is characteristic at the time when RSL=6.8 k (the "L" level voltage is under 2V) coincides with that at the time when Pin2 of the SPW31002S has been used at an open state.
